C# Класс Manager.IntegrationTest.Console.Host.Program

Показать файл Открыть проект

Private Properties

Свойство Тип Описание
ConsoleCtrlCheck bool
CreateNodeConfigurationFile System.IO.FileInfo
CurrentDomainOnDomainUnload void
CurrentDomain_UnhandledException void
SetConsoleCtrlHandler bool
StartLoadBalancerProxy void
StartSelfHosting void

Открытые методы

Метод Описание
CopyManagerConfigurationFile ( FileInfo managerConfigFile, int i, int portNumber, int allowedDowntimeSeconds, Uri &uri ) : FileInfo
CopyManagerConfigurationFile ( FileInfo managerConfigFile, int i, string baseAddress, int allowedDowntimeSeconds, Uri &uri ) : FileInfo
CreateNodeConfigurationFile ( FileInfo nodeConfigurationFile, string newConfigurationFileName, string nodeName, string port, int pingToManagerSeconds, string handlerAssembly ) : FileInfo
GetAllNodes ( ) : List
GetAllmanagers ( ) : List
Main ( string args ) : void
ShutDownManager ( string friendlyName ) : bool
ShutDownNode ( string friendlyName ) : bool
StartNewManager ( string &friendlyname ) : void
StartNewNode ( string &friendlyName ) : void

Приватные методы

Метод Описание
ConsoleCtrlCheck ( CtrlTypes ctrlType ) : bool
CreateNodeConfigurationFile ( int i ) : FileInfo
CurrentDomainOnDomainUnload ( object sender, EventArgs eventArgs ) : void
CurrentDomain_UnhandledException ( object sender, UnhandledExceptionEventArgs e ) : void
SetConsoleCtrlHandler ( HandlerRoutine handler, bool add ) : bool
StartLoadBalancerProxy ( IEnumerable managerUriList ) : void
StartSelfHosting ( ) : void

Описание методов

CopyManagerConfigurationFile() публичный статический Метод

public static CopyManagerConfigurationFile ( FileInfo managerConfigFile, int i, int portNumber, int allowedDowntimeSeconds, Uri &uri ) : FileInfo
managerConfigFile System.IO.FileInfo
i int
portNumber int
allowedDowntimeSeconds int
uri System.Uri
Результат System.IO.FileInfo

CopyManagerConfigurationFile() публичный статический Метод

public static CopyManagerConfigurationFile ( FileInfo managerConfigFile, int i, string baseAddress, int allowedDowntimeSeconds, Uri &uri ) : FileInfo
managerConfigFile System.IO.FileInfo
i int
baseAddress string
allowedDowntimeSeconds int
uri System.Uri
Результат System.IO.FileInfo

CreateNodeConfigurationFile() публичный статический Метод

public static CreateNodeConfigurationFile ( FileInfo nodeConfigurationFile, string newConfigurationFileName, string nodeName, string port, int pingToManagerSeconds, string handlerAssembly ) : FileInfo
nodeConfigurationFile System.IO.FileInfo
newConfigurationFileName string
nodeName string
port string
pingToManagerSeconds int
handlerAssembly string
Результат System.IO.FileInfo

GetAllNodes() публичный статический Метод

public static GetAllNodes ( ) : List
Результат List

GetAllmanagers() публичный статический Метод

public static GetAllmanagers ( ) : List
Результат List

Main() публичный статический Метод

public static Main ( string args ) : void
args string
Результат void

ShutDownManager() публичный статический Метод

public static ShutDownManager ( string friendlyName ) : bool
friendlyName string
Результат bool

ShutDownNode() публичный статический Метод

public static ShutDownNode ( string friendlyName ) : bool
friendlyName string
Результат bool

StartNewManager() публичный статический Метод

public static StartNewManager ( string &friendlyname ) : void
friendlyname string
Результат void

StartNewNode() публичный статический Метод

public static StartNewNode ( string &friendlyName ) : void
friendlyName string
Результат void